Description:
Rudresh is a Hindu name of Indian origin, derived from the Sanskrit words ‘rudra’ (meaning ‘lord of the storm’) and ‘ish’ (meaning ‘lord’). It is commonly found among the Brahmin communities of India, especially in the states of Karnataka, Andhra Pradesh, and Telangana. The name has a long history, with its earliest known use dating back to the Vedic period. It was also used in the Puranas, the ancient Hindu scriptures. In modern times, the name is associated with the Hindu god Shiva, who is referred to as Rudra in the Vedas. Rudresh is a popular name in India, with many variations.
